St. Andrew's School, Osaka is known as Momoyama Gakuin High School in Japanese. It is a premier academic high school in the Kansai Area, which includes Osaka, Kobe, Nara, and Kyoto. Our campus is located on the southern border of Osaka City. The school was established by missionaries from England 125 years ago. It must have been quite a radical undertaking, what with Japan barely opened to the rest of the world, and distrustful of organized religion in the West. But the seeds that were planted took root, and St. Andrew’s School has been a leader among private schools in the area ever since.
